Welcome Matt Madden, my first guest and best friend. Here we discuss growing up as a victim of bullying, the comforting escape he found in music and theatre, and the necessity of having someone to lean on.
We explore focusing on the positive, reaching outward to reach inward, always "living in the question", and letting time carry us like a wave.
Books mentioned: No Mud, No Lotus by Thich Nhat Hanh and The Artist's Way by Julia Cameron.
